CEO of GSI Commerce’s Global Marketing Services Division Joins Adelphi University’s Board of Trustees

Adelphi University has elected Christopher D. Saridakis ’90, chief executive officer of GSI Commerce Inc.’s (Nasdaq: GSIC) Global Marketing Services division, to its Board of Trustees. GSI provides e-commerce and digital marketing services to more than 500 retailers and brands. He will serve on the Board’s advancement and finance committees.
“Joining the Board of Trustees offers me the opportunity to continue to support my alma mater,” said Mr. Saridakis. “I am proud of the University, its role as a relevant and engaged regional partner, and its ongoing commitment to student success. I am honored to join the Board.”
“On behalf of my colleagues, it is a privilege to welcome Mr. Saridakis to the Board,” said Adelphi University Board of Trustees Chairman Thomas F. Motamed ’71. “At a time where technology and communications are changing so rapidly, we are confident Chris will add extraordinary professional experience and valuable skills to the University.”
Mr. Saridakis joined GSI Commerce as chief executive officer of its Global Marketing Services division in May 2010. In this role, he oversees GSI’s existing marketing services businesses, e-Dialog, an email marketing provider, and TrueAction, a digital agency, and is responsible for running the company’s overall marketing services strategy. He joined GSI from Gannett Co., Inc. where he served as senior vice president and chief digital officer since 2008 and head of Gannett Marketing Services. Prior to joining Gannett, Mr. Saridakis was CEO of PointRoll, and helped build the company into the leader in rich media, serving the world’s top creative and media ad agencies. He has also served as senior vice president and general manager of DoubleClick’s Global TechSolution division.
Mr. Saridakis received his B.A. in economics from Adelphi in 1990. In 2010, he was named the Outstanding Alumnus at the University’s 10th annual President’s Gala, the University’s major annual fundraiser for student scholarships. He lives in Wilmington, Delaware, with his wife and four children.

About Adelphi University: Adelphi University, chartered in 1896, was the first institution of higher education for the liberal arts and sciences on Long Island. Through its schools and programs—The College of Arts and Sciences, Derner Institute of Advanced Psychological Studies, Honors College, Ruth S. Ammon School of Education, University College, and the Schools of Business, Nursing, and Social Work—the co-educational university offers undergraduate and graduate degrees as well as professional and educational programs for adults. Adelphi University currently enrolls nearly 8,500 students from 41 states and 63 foreign countries. With its main campus in Garden City and centers in Manhattan, Hauppauge, and Poughkeepsie, the University maintains a commitment to liberal studies in tandem with rigorous professional preparation and active citizenship.
